On 21-10-18, 23:54, Dmitry Osipenko wrote:
> Voltage regulators may be not available on some variations of HW, allow to
> request stub voltage regulators by OPP core in a such case to reduce code
> churning within drivers.
>
> Signed-off-by: Dmitry Osipenko <digetx@gmail.com>
> ---
> drivers/cpufreq/cpufreq-dt.c | 2 +-
> drivers/cpufreq/ti-cpufreq.c | 3 ++-
> drivers/opp/core.c | 9 +++++++--
> include/linux/pm_opp.h | 4 ++--
> 4 files changed, 12 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)
>
> diff --git a/drivers/cpufreq/cpufreq-dt.c b/drivers/cpufreq/cpufreq-dt.c
> index e58bfcb1169e..6ebca472ec76 100644
> --- a/drivers/cpufreq/cpufreq-dt.c
> +++ b/drivers/cpufreq/cpufreq-dt.c
> @@ -196,7 +196,7 @@ static int cpufreq_init(struct cpufreq_policy *policy)
> */
> name = find_supply_name(cpu_dev);
> if (name) {
> - opp_table = dev_pm_opp_set_regulators(cpu_dev, &name, 1);
> + opp_table = dev_pm_opp_set_regulators(cpu_dev, &name, 1, false);
> if (IS_ERR(opp_table)) {
> ret = PTR_ERR(opp_table);
> dev_err(cpu_dev, "Failed to set regulator for cpu%d: %d\n",
Have you actually tested this stuff ? The cpufreq-dt driver will
probably fail to probe if the CPU node has a "-supply" property, but
no regulator matching that.
